The cheapest way to get from Leuk to Ascona is to drive which costs SFr 20 - SFr 30 and takes 2h 7m.
The fastest way to get from Leuk to Ascona is to drive which takes 2h 7m and costs SFr 20 - SFr 30.
The distance between Leuk and Ascona is 116 km. The road distance is 131.4 km.
The best way to get from Leuk to Ascona without a car is to train which takes 4h 18m and costs SFr 23 - SFr 60.
It takes approximately 4h 18m to get from Leuk to Ascona, including transfers.
The best way to get from Leuk to Ascona is to train which takes 4h 18m and costs SFr 23 - SFr 60.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s SFr 27 - SFr 65 and takes 4h 41m.
Yes, the driving distance between Leuk to Ascona is 131 km. It takes approximately 2h 7m to drive from Leuk to Ascona.

What companies run services between Leuk, Switzerland and Ascona, Switzerland?
FART operates a train from Domodossola to Locarno FART hourly. Tickets cost CHF 9–13 and the journey takes 1h 54m. Alternatively, FART operates a bus from Domodossola, stazione to Locarno, Stazione once daily. Tickets cost CHF 13–19 and the journey takes 1h 54m.
